Blockchain technology has unlocked a digital, autonomous, dispersed ledger that anyone from around the world can transact on. Negotiating on the blockchain involves connecting with wallet addresses. Each cryptocurrency has a wallet and each wallet has an address.

In some cases a wallet will have more than one receiving address. If you unintentionally send one to a wallet address that belongs to a different cryptocurrency, for circumstances, send out Bitcoin to an Ethereum address, then the funds you send out will be lost permanently. If just there was a way to connect a legible domain name to a wallet address.

permits individuals to create their username for crypto and build decentralized digital identities. The startup, which sells domains with specific TLDs for as low as $5, has helped individuals register over 2.5 million domains to date. A few of the popular TLDs it uses include.crypto,. coin,. bitcoin,. x,.888,. nft and.dao.
A virtual land rush for NFT internet domains, which use public blockchains that give users total ownership of their information, helped among the few companies that established such websites declare a $1 billion evaluation today.

raised $65 million in a series A equity funding round, attaining so-called unicorn status. The financing was led by Pantera Capital with participants including Alchemy Ventures, OKG Investments and PolygonMATIC -3.8%, in addition to previous financiers Increase VC and Draper Associates.

Having a name permits users to not trouble with sharing their meaninglessly long wallet addresses with pals and services. It also has integrations with over 300 applications, including OpenSea, Coinbase wallet, Rainbow wallet, Chainlink, Brave browser and ETHMail. Over 150 DApps support the startup’s Login with Unstoppable product, a single sign-on service for Ethereum and Polygon, addressing among the uncomfortable experiences plaguing the crypto community.

Blockchain name supplier today announced a cooperation with privacy-oriented web browser Brave that enables native internet browser support for the crypto name business. With the most recent Brave internet browser upgrade, Brave users on desktop and Android platforms have access to 30,000 decentralized websites and 700,000 blockchain names signed up with.

” We are delighted to deal with to enable decentralized DNS to a wider audience. At Brave, we see Web3 as a stepping stone to the future of digital ownership and decentralization,” stated Brian Bondy, co-founder and CTO of Brave.” was a natural fit for us, providing our users access to the decentralized web with the ability to go to any.crypto name. From registering.cryptos to hosting an art gallery, to receiving and sending crypto, the possibilities are endless for Brave users.”

Introduced in 2018, provides.crypto and other top-level names to users without any renewal charges. When a user claims a, it is minted as an on the Ethereum blockchain, approving the user full ownership and control. These.crypto names can point to content hosted online, IPFS, or to cryptocurrency addresses, making it easy to get and send over 70 various cryptocurrencies throughout 40+ cryptocurrency wallets and exchanges, consisting of Coinbase Wallet, Litewallet, OKEx and MyEtherWallet.

” We’re on a mission to onboard 3 billion individuals to the decentralized web, and Brave is bringing us millions of people closer to that goal. We see Web3 as the future of the web, where everybody has ownership and control of their own material,” said Matthew Gould, Co-Founder and CEO of. “Brave’s integration with means easy access to the decentralized web without the hassle of browser extensions or custom-made DNS settings.”

was founded in 2018 by Matthew Gould, the present CEO, who saw a requirement for it to be much easier for users to interact with crypto addresses. The objective of is to be like the DNS system that entered into location, so users did not need to learn IP addresses in order to get to sites, except for crypto addresses.

In this manner they have actually been successful significantly, as they have created a domain system that enables users to set up payments for 276 digital assets under a single domain name, while also having the ability to be used as a completely working site that can even have actually dApps developed onto them because the domain is hosted on the blockchain. With a single payment and no yearly renewal charges, is an interesting tool for crypto users.

Is Safe?

is very safe due to the fact that as soon as claimed the domains exist under your address on blockchain, suggesting they are as safe and secure as the blockchain itself.

It is twice as safe because this also indicates that the domain can not be blocked by anybody besides you, so your site is never ever at risk of being down due to censorship. The site for acquiring the domains is safe as well and can be secured with two-factor authentication.

How Much is ?

The expense of depends upon a two primary factors, though it needs to be noted that acquiring a domain is a one-time expense and requires no yearly renewals of any sort.

The first factor is the cost of the domain itself, this can vary from $20 USD to well over $1000 USD depending on the domain you select, as expense is based upon domain type (. crypto is more than.wallet for instance), and the length of the domain name, with shorter domains costing extra. In addition, there are superior domains that cost 10s of thousands.
